    Getting a house that old can be pretty costly in the long run. Make sure you get a home inspector who knows how to do old houses and check all the pipes, electrical, etc. We sold a 100+ yr old house in NW PA about a year ago. The buyers demo'd it and re-built anyway, but the pipes had frozen every winter for about 15 years and the electrical went out if it got windy.
